About Н. Е. Кузьменко

Н. Е. Кузьменко is a scholar working on Physical and Theoretical Chemistry, Spectroscopy and Catalysis, having authored 55 papers that have together received 419 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(15 papers),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(13 papers) and Nanocluster Synthesis and Applications (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Spectroscopy (148 citations),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(180 citations) and Atmospheric Science (79 citations). Н. Е. Кузьменко has collaborated with scholars based in Russia, Tajikistan and Mexico. Frequent co-authors include L. A. Kuznetsova, D. А. Pichugina, Alexander F. Shestakov, A. V. Stolyarov, Boris I. Kharisov, A. F. Shestakov, R. Ferber, С. Н. Ланин, С. А. Николаев and E. A. Pazyuk. Their work appears in journals such as Physical Review A, Chemical Physics Letters and Physical Chemistry Chemical Physics.
